Unlock instant, AI-driven research and patent intelligence for your innovation.

Verification-Based Blockchain Consensus Approach

A blockchain and consensus technology, applied in the blockchain field, can solve the problem of low consensus efficiency of network nodes

Active Publication Date: 2021-05-04
NANJING UNIV OF SCI & TECH
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] The Practical Byzantine Fault Tolerance Protocol is suitable for the consortium chain environment, but the consensus efficiency of network nodes is not high, especially when the number of network nodes increases, the number of network communications and the amount of communication data increase rapidly, and a targeted consensus algorithm needs to be designed to improve consensus efficiency and reduce network traffic

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Verification-Based Blockchain Consensus Approach
  • Verification-Based Blockchain Consensus Approach

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020] It is easy to understand that, according to the technical solution of the present invention, those skilled in the art can imagine various implementations of the verification-based blockchain consensus method of the present invention without changing the essence of the present invention. Therefore, the following specific embodiments and drawings are only exemplary descriptions of the technical solution of the present invention, and should not be regarded as the entirety of the present invention or as a limitation or limitation on the technical solution of the present invention.

[0021] figure 1 It is a schematic diagram of the consensus process flow of a specific embodiment of the verification-based blockchain consensus method. According to an embodiment of the present invention, assume that C is the client, A 0 、A 1 、A 2 、A 3 There are 4 verification nodes participating in the consensus, among which, A 0 、A 1 、A 2 is a normal operating node, A 3 for downtime no...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a block chain consensus method based on verification. The client sends the request message to the verification initiating node; the verification initiating node organizes pre-prepared messages and broadcasts them to other verification nodes in the network; other verification nodes organize signed messages and returns them to the verification initiating node; the verification initiating node counts the number of signed messages correctly received, reaching When the threshold is given, the submission operation of the node is executed, and the verification message is broadcast to other verification nodes in the network; other verification nodes verify multiple digital signatures in the message in turn, and when the number of digital signatures that pass the verification reaches the given threshold, Execute the submit operation of this node, and organize the verification reply message to be returned to the verification initiating node; the verification initiating node organizes the response message to be fed back to the client. Compared with the practical Byzantine fault-tolerant consensus method, the present invention reduces the number of times of network communication and the amount of communication data, and improves the efficiency of consensus.

Description

technical field [0001] The invention relates to the technical field of block chains, in particular to a verification-based block chain consensus method. Background technique [0002] Blockchain is a decentralized distributed database technology with the participation of various nodes, which has the characteristics of complete traceability, decentralization and de-credit. The blockchain does not have a central organization, and the consistency of the information of each node is guaranteed through the consensus mechanism of the blockchain. The blockchain consensus mechanism is based on the Byzantine fault-tolerant distributed consensus algorithm and a communication model for transmitting and synchronizing data according to specific business scenarios. The consensus algorithm is one of the core technologies of the blockchain, and the performance of the algorithm directly affects the effectiveness of the system. [0003] Currently common consensus algorithms include workload p...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H04L29/06H04L9/32
CPCH04L9/3247H04L63/123
Inventor 张重阳翟晓军
Owner NANJING UNIV OF SCI & TECH